What affects the price

Cleaning costs depend on a few specific things regarding your fireplace setup. We look at the total height of the chimney, the number of flues, and how much creosote buildup has accumulated over time. If your chimney has been neglected for several seasons, or if there are blockages like animal nests or heavy debris, the labor required increases. The type of liner and the fireplace architecture also play a role in the complexity of the service.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

A chimney sweep is a professional maintenance service focused on removing creosote, soot, and debris from your flue. This process is critical for preventing chimney fires and improving the airflow of your fireplace. Most homeowners need this service once a year to ensure the system is clear and functioning. We use industrial vacuums and brushes to clean the chimney thoroughly, leaving your home as clean as we found it.

Do I need to prepare my home for a chimney sweep?

You don't need to do extensive preparation for a chimney sweep in New York. The licensed professionals come equipped to handle the cleaning process efficiently. It's helpful to clear the area around your fireplace. This provides them with easy access to their equipment and the chimney.

Will the fire department clean my chimney in New York?

No, the fire department in New York does not offer chimney cleaning services. Their role is focused on emergency response and public safety. For routine chimney maintenance and inspections, you should always contact a professional chimney sweep. They have the specialized tools and expertise.
